the basics:

ThinkPad T43 2687-D4U

Original description:
P M 750
512MB RAM...........................now 1GB (2x512MB)
40GB 5400rpm HDD...............now 40GB/4200rpm
15 SXGA+(1400x1050) TFT LCD
64MB ATI Radeon X300
24x24x24x/8x CD-RW/DVD
Intel 802.11a/b/g wireless(MPCI)
Modem(CDC)
1Gb Ethernet(LOM)
UltraNav
Secure Chip
6 cell Li-Ion battery...................9-cell in red, about 90 minutes runtime
WinXP Pro

imperfections/caveats:

- wear and sticker residue on the lid
- normal shine (no worn letters) on the keyboard
- LCD is reddish for a few seconds on initial boot, but clears quickly, there is also one dark pressure mark on it.
- COA is illegible (XP Pro)
- Warranty has expired
